Methods to follow if your Crosscall Trekker-X3 fell into the water

If perhaps you need to recover your Crosscall Trekker-X3 in operating order, we highly recommend that you follow the steps below.

Do not attempt to turn the Crosscall Trekker-X3 back on after getting out the water

The first thing to do when the Crosscall Trekker-X3 has fallen into the water is to shut off the phone. In truth, if it did not switch off, turn it off without doing any other manipulation. In the event that it is already off, do not attempt to turn it back on for the moment. In the event that the Crosscall Trekker-X3 is turned on and wet, you could generate a short circuit and consequently toast the phone.

Remove detachable components

Once the Crosscall Trekker-X3 is out of the water and turned off, it will have to be disassembled to the highest possible. Meaning that it will probably be essential to take out the shell, the SIM card, the SD card and the electric battery if possible. Once completed, put all of these items to dry and proceed to the next step.

Aspire the water that is in your Crosscall Trekker-X3

By using a straw, you have got to suck up the water that is contained in your Crosscall Trekker-X3. For this, you merely need to glue the straw over areas like buttons and vacuum. Once you believe you have aspired all the water from your Crosscall Trekker-X3, you will be able to start drying it.

Dry the Crosscall Trekker-X3

The fourth step is to dry the phone. For this, we recommend you to put it in front of a ventilator a number of hours. Prevent using techniques that cause the phone to heat up or damage the phone. Once it is done, we recommend you to leave the Crosscall Trekker-X3 in rice for 24 or 48 hours. The rice will consequently absorb the wetness that remains in the Crosscall Trekker-X3.

Reassemble the components and turn on the Crosscall Trekker-X3

When you have completed the previous steps, your Crosscall Trekker-X3 should be dry. So now you can try to turn on the Crosscall Trekker-X3. In the event that this does not function, we recommend you to wait some days or to bring the Crosscall Trekker-X3 to a repairshop.

What should not be done if the Crosscall Trekker-X3 has fallen into the water

You will find a number of points not to do when ever your Crosscall Trekker-X3 has fallen into the water. The first of all is to try to turn the phone back on just after. This can demolish the Crosscall Trekker-X3. Following, it is strongly advised not to use a heat source to dry the Crosscall Trekker-X3. Certainly, solutions which include oven or hair dryer heat the components and may damage them. At last, to get the water out of the phone, do not shake it. Certainly, it could additionally damage the Crosscall Trekker-X3.
